Our verdict is Likely benign. The variant received -3 ACMG points: 2P and 5B. PP2PP3BP6BS2
The NM_001035.3(RYR2):c.8416C>T(p.Arg2806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000145 in 1,443,398 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R2806H) has been classified as Uncertain significance.

The p.R2806C variant (also known as c.8416C>T), located in coding exon 56 of the RYR2 gene, results from a C to T substitution at nucleotide position 8416. The arginine at codon 2806 is replaced by cysteine, an amino acid with highly dissimilar properties. This amino acid position is highly conserved in available vertebrate species. In addition, the in silico prediction for this alteration is inconclusive. Since supporting evidence is limited at this time, the clinical significance of this alteration remains unclear. -
